They’re called leather britches … WebUse the amount of dried shuck beans you need (a little makes a lot) and soak overnight in hot water. Drain water and rinse well with cold water. Put in kettle, with water to cover. Boil for about 1 hour, drain and rinse again. Put cold water above level of beans in the kettle and add salt pork that has been cut into bite-size pieces. Next day, pour off the water in which the beans were soaked and rinse them well. Put the beans into a large pot with a close fitting lid. Add 3/4 teaspoon salt. 3 cups of water, and a 2 inch square of salt pork. (can use bacon grease). Cook over medium heat for about 3 hours, adding more water if need.

Shucky beans (also called " leather britches ") are an American legume dish, made of dried green beans that have been preserved for winter consumption.
